Chemical-Biological Engineering (Course 10-B)
Department of Chemical Engineering
Bachelor of Science in Chemical-Biological Engineering
General Institute Requirements (GIRs)
The General Institute Requirements include a Communication Requirement that is integrated into both the HASS Requirement and the requirements of each major; see details below.

The units for any subject that counts as one of the 17 GIR subjects cannot also be counted as units required beyond the GIRs.
| 1 | 18.032 Differential Equations is also an acceptable option. |
| 2 | May be satisfied with a second term of 10.492A, 10.492B, 10.493, 10.494A or 10.494B; or a second term of 10.490 (with permission of instructor). Graduate subjects may not be used as restricted electives. In addition, the following undergraduate subjects may not be used as restricted electives: 10.04, 10.792[J] 10.806, 10.910, 10.911, 10.UR, 10.URG, and 10.THU. |
